16 import os
17 import robot
18 from robot.run import RobotFramework
19 from robot.conf.settings import RobotSettings
20 from robot.running.builder import TestSuiteBuilder
21 from robot.running.model import TestSuite
22
23
24 def get_suite_list(*datasources, **options):
25     class _MyRobotFramework(RobotFramework):
26         def main(self, datasources, **options):
27             # copied from robot.run.RobotFramework.main
28             settings = RobotSettings(options)
29             suite = TestSuiteBuilder(settings['SuiteNames'],
30                                      settings['WarnOnSkipped']).build(*datasources)
31             suite.configure(**settings.suite_config)
32
33             return suite
34
35     # Options are in robot.conf.settings
36     suite = _MyRobotFramework().execute(*datasources, **options)
37     if isinstance(suite, TestSuite):
38         suites = []
39         suites.append(suite)
40         append_new = True
41         while append_new:
42             append_new = False
43             tmp = []
44             for s in suites:
45                 if len(s.suites._items) > 0:
46                     for i in s.suites._items:
47                         tmp.append(i)
48                     append_new = True
49                 else:
50                     tmp.append(s)
51             suites = tmp
52         return suites
53     else:
54         # TODO: add from robot.errors typ error
55         return []
56
57
58 def run_suites(test_dir, suites, out_dir="./outputs", **options):
59     # TODO: add logic
60
61     try:
62         for f in os.listdir(out_dir):
63             os.remove('/'.join((out_dir, f)))
64     except OSError:
65         pass
66     if not os.path.exists(out_dir):
67         os.makedirs(out_dir)
68
69     for s in suites:
70         longname = s.longname
71         varfile=[]
72         varfile.append('resources/libraries/python/topology.py')
73
74         # TODO: check testcases Tags
75
76         with open('{}/{}.out'.format(out_dir, longname), 'w') as out, \
77              open('{}/{}.log'.format(out_dir, longname), 'w') as debug:
78             robot.run(test_dir,
79                       suite=[longname],
80                       output='{}/{}.xml'.format(out_dir, longname),
81                       debugfile=debug,
82                       log=None,
83                       report=None,
84                       stdout=out,
85                       variablefile=varfile,
86                       **options)
87
88
89 def parse_outputs(out_dir='./'):
90     outs = ['/'.join((out_dir, file)) for file in os.listdir(out_dir) if file.endswith('.xml')]
91     robot.rebot(*outs, merge=True)
92
93
94 if __name__ == "__main__":
95     i = []
96     e = []
97     # i = ['bd', 'ip']
98     # i = ['hw']
99     # e = ['hw']
100     test_dir = "./tests"
101     out_dir = "./outputs"
102
103     suite_list = get_suite_list(test_dir, include=i, exclude=e, output=None, dryrun=True)
104     run_suites(test_dir, suite_list, include=i, exclude=e, out_dir=out_dir)
105     parse_outputs(out_dir=out_dir)
